Support to Black Lives Matter

Deciem, the make of The Ordinary, has asked consumers to join in the conversation on racial inequality. As well as donating US$100,000 to Black Lives Matter and The NAACP Legal Defence & Educational Fund, social media users have been asked to send in a one minute video, or written message, on the subject to voices@deciem.com.

"Our team have been actively sharing their voices in the fight against racism and inequality," the brand wrote. "From tomorrow [1 June], our Instagram Stories will become a dedicated space to continue this conversation."[1]
